Colour
straw
air Nose
very typical with lots of ripe green fruits, melon, lemon barley water, chopped hazelnut and lime zest. The kind of cask that the new owners were filling into any wine cask they could get their hands on only a decade or two ago; as ever, slow and steady wins the race. With water: becoming leaner, drier and more dominated by cereals, canvass, hessian, olive oil and dried herbs
restaurant Palate
a slightly taut and narrow profile, with a fair bit of white pepper, watercress, aniseed, crushed aspirin and fresh linens. Also quite a few pure cereal notes, some chalky qualities and things like vase water, bay leaf and caraway. Very typical of this era of production in my view. With water: again, a lovely combo of lemony and cereal qualities, with a few glimmers of those initial green fruits and even a wee coastal impression coming through
timer Finish
medium, again rather peppery, more vase water, more olive oil and a little salinity in the aftertaste
